This solution is generated by ChatGPT, correctness is not guaranteed.

AI solution for Interview Question on BFE.dev
126. How would you debug a web page and find the bad code?

As an AI language model, I don't have personal experiences. But, generally, here are some common ways to debug a web page and find the bad code:

  1. Check the browser console: The browser console displays any errors or warnings that occur on the web page. Look for red error messages and try to fix them.

  2. Use a debugging tool: Many browsers have built-in debugging tools that allow you to step through code and inspect variables. You can also set breakpoints and see where code is failing.

  3. Validate the HTML and CSS: Ensure that the HTML and CSS are valid by using a validator tool.

  4. Use a linter: A linter can help you identify code that may not be syntaxically correct.

  5. Check the network tab: The network tab in your browser's dev tools can show you which requests are being made and how long they are taking. This can help you identify performance bottlenecks.

  6. Use browser extensions: Browser extensions like Firebug or Chrome DevTools can help you pinpoint errors in code and provide helpful features for troubleshooting.

  7. Check for compatibility issues: If your code is not working in a specific browser, check for compatibility issues by researching specific browser quirks or using a testing tool.

  8. Simplify your code: If all else fails, try simplifying your code and gradually adding functionality until you find where the problem lies.